How does Tongwei Solar improve solar panel performance during cloudy days

As I delve into the fascinating advancements by tongwei , I find that they are making great strides in improving solar panel performance, especially during cloudy days. This has always been a challenging aspect in solar technology. Solar panels typically rely on direct sunlight to generate electricity, and under cloudy conditions, energy output diminishes. However, Tongwei Solar, with its innovative technologies, has stepped up to address this issue.

For those curious about the backbone of their success, it primarily involves enhancing photovoltaic cells’ efficiency. Currently, typical solar panels on the market convert about 15% to 20% of solar energy into electricity under standard conditions. Yet Tongwei Solar has been pushing the boundaries. Their monocrystalline silicon solar panels have shown efficiency rates as high as 22.5%. Achieving this level of efficiency under normal conditions is already impressive, but Tongwei goes beyond; even on cloudy days, their panels maintain higher levels of output compared to competitors.

The secret behind Tongwei’s success lies in their cutting-edge PERC (Passivated Emitter and Rear Cell) technology. This technology involves adding a passivation layer on the backside of the solar cells, which enhances the cell’s ability to retain light and reflect unused photons back into the cell. This small yet significant technological tweak allows more electrons to be knocked loose, thus generating more electricity even when sunlight isn’t at its peak. Given that cloudy conditions can reduce direct sunlight by up to 80%, technologies like PERC are indispensable for maintaining solar panel efficiency.
